Handover note — Crumbwheel order cutoffs.

Welcome aboard. The bakery cutoff rule in Crumbwheel closes same-day orders at 14:00 local to each storefront, not UTC — this has bitten us twice. Holiday overrides live in the calendar service and take precedence silently, so always check there first when a cutoff looks wrong. To unlock the calendar service's admin console after a restart, enter the recovery passphrase below.

vault phrase of bagap-bahaf = silion-pelox-sorox-casdor-quenwyn-fraax-eliox-praael-kelion-quenvan-kasox-rusael-norius-belvan

**14:22 — Planner regression confirmed.** Heads up for the new folks: this is where it got interesting. The Burrowdeep query planner started picking a full scan over the tenant index after the stats refresh, and p99 on the orders endpoint tripled. Nobody changed query code — classic planner trap. We pinned the old plan while Saffi dug into the stats job. The offending build's trace is right below.

pipeline stamp: htk31_f769b577b3028a4e9958e5bb8d1259a

Quarterly Planning Note — Warranty Overrun

Branch managers: warranty costs on the Halden range ran 38% over plan last quarter, driven by a faulty valve batch from Torwick Components. The supplier has accepted partial liability; replacement stock arrives within six weeks. Budget adjustments will hit branch P&Ls in the next cycle. Continue logging claims promptly — incomplete records weakened our recovery position. The planning implications are captured in the note below.

board note of baweg-bawig: Project Tamath slips by six weeks because of the audit delay.

Runbook — Queuescale 1.9 rollout. This release tunes the queue-depth autoscaler: scale-up now triggers at 500 pending jobs instead of 800, and cooldown drops to 2 minutes. As a new contractor, note that the autoscaler config ships inside the release artifact, not as a separate config map, so a bad build means a full redeploy to fix. Verify the staging soak ran 24 hours without flapping. The artifact must be signed before promotion; use the key below.

release key, kawif-hawep: bky13_X7TGuRG4Zu4ZJ